(clients = await oidcService.listClients((e.target as HTMLInputElement).value, pagination))}
/>
Logo
Name
Actions
{#if clients.data.length === 0}
No OIDC clients found
{:else}
{#each clients.data as client}
{#if client.hasLogo}
{/if}
{client.name}
{/each}
{/if}
{#if clients?.data?.length ?? 0 > 0}
(clients = await oidcService.listClients(search, {
page: p,
limit: pagination.limit
}))}
bind:page={clients.pagination.currentPage}
let:pages
let:currentPage
>
{#each pages as page (page.key)}
{#if page.type === 'ellipsis'}
{:else}
{page.value}
{/if}
{/each}
{/if}